[QUOTE="GoldFinger1969, post: 3436704, member: 73489"]Yup, I get it. What is surprising is that I can understand this approach on low-priced stuff like regular Silver Certificates. If someone pays $150 for a SC that is really only worth $100 or $50, it isn't going to break them. So I can see someone who isn't a regular currency collector paying way over market. However...on more expensive stuff....where you are only going to get committed collectors, I still see stuff way over FMV. High-denomination notes, Gold Certificates, etc -- I see stuff costing $1,000 - $15,000 -- and it's way over recent sales or listed price. So you wonder who they are banking on to take it off their hands. Nobody is buying a graded Gold Certificate costing thousands for a bday or graduation present. Graded Silver Certificate, maybe.[/QUOTE]
